Jon's Current Read

David Scurry Grant is not a subdivision with a spec sheet — it is a pocket of Jacksonville where the housing stock spans more than a century, from 1900 up through 2023, with the midpoint sitting around 1981. That range is the whole story on price. With a median living area near 2,305 square feet, you are not shopping a uniform product; you are shopping individual houses whose condition, systems, and updates matter far more than any per-square-foot shortcut. Price here is condition-driven, and two homes of similar size can be worlds apart.

With about 64 homes and only two closings in the recent window, this is a thin, low-turnover market. That cuts both ways. Sellers of a well-kept or updated home face limited direct competition, but they also have few recent comps to lean on, so pricing takes judgment rather than a spreadsheet. Buyers should expect to move on the right house when it appears and to underwrite the property on its own merits, not on neighborhood averages.

A century of stock in one small pocket

The defining feature here is age spread. When your oldest homes date to 1900 and your newest to 2023, you are looking at everything from early-century construction to recent infill, with a median build year around 1981. Practically, that means inspection is not a formality — it is the deal. Roof age, electrical, plumbing, and foundation vary enormously across this stock, and the size of a home tells you little about what it will cost to own. Budget your diligence accordingly.

The high homestead share — about 80% owner-occupied — points to a settled, hold-oriented community rather than a churn of investor turnover. Combined with the small home count, that tends to keep inventory tight and listings sporadic. If you want in, patience and readiness matter more than negotiating leverage, because the next comparable home may not surface for a while.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is David Scurry Grant a buyer's or seller's market right now?
As of July 15, 2026, David Scurry Grant is roughly balanced: 6.0 months of supply at the current sales pace (realMLS live counts).
How many homes are in David Scurry Grant?
The Florida DOR 2025 assessment roll shows 64 homes plus 1 vacant residential lots in David Scurry Grant (public records).
What share of David Scurry Grant is owner-occupied?
80% of David Scurry Grant parcels carry a homestead exemption on the 2025 Florida DOR roll, the owner-occupancy proxy in public records.
When were the homes in David Scurry Grant built?
Homes in David Scurry Grant were built between 1900 and 2023, with a median year built of 1981.5 (FL DOR 2025 roll).
Do cash buyers compete in David Scurry Grant?
Cash buyers took 0% of David Scurry Grant sales in the 12 months ending July 2019 (0 of 3 closings, realMLS).
